2. Meditate for 10 Minutes
Even a few minutes of mindfulness can do wonders for your mental state. Meditation is a powerful tool for mental and emotional well-being that has been practised for centuries. In today’s busy world, finding time for ourselves can be a challenge, but taking just 10 minutes to meditate can have a profound positive effect on our overall state of mind. This simple practice allows us to disconnect from the hustle and bustle of daily life and find some much-needed alone time.
The act of meditation involves sitting or lying down in a comfortable position and focusing on deep, mindful breaths. By doing so, we are able to quiet our minds and let go of racing thoughts or worries. It is the perfect way to give our brains a break and recharge. If you find it difficult to mediate due to your monkey brain – I have this problem too! – try guided meditation. I love the app Meditation Moments, and it’s ideal if you don’t have much time, as you can choose the length of each meditation. Some are just 5 minutes long but still manage to help you recharge and focus for the day or help you sleep well at night.
3. Take a Yoga Class
Yoga has been practised for centuries and has numerous benefits for our well-being. Taking a yoga class at home or in a studio is a great way to relax your mind and body. Your future self will thank your past self for taking the time to incorporate yoga into your routine. The deep breathing techniques used in yoga can help calm the mind and reduce stress levels. This not only helps us feel more relaxed but also contributes to our overall health. In addition, practising yoga regularly can lead to an increase in energy levels. This is because yoga helps to release tension and improve circulation throughout the body. As we move through different poses and hold them for varying lengths of time, we are also building strength and flexibility, which can benefit us in our daily lives.
Another benefit of yoga is its ability to improve posture and balance. Many of us spend a lot of time hunched over desks or slouched on couches, which can lead to poor posture. By practicing yoga, we can strengthen the muscles that support our spine and help us maintain proper alignment. This not only improves our physical appearance but also reduces the risk of injury and back pain. Yoga also has numerous mental health benefits. Along with reducing stress and anxiety, it can also boost self-esteem and confidence. Yoga provides numerous physical and mental benefits.

13. Lose Yourself in Nature
Taking a walk in nature is the perfect way to disconnect from our busy lives and reconnect with ourselves. Whether it’s a leisurely stroll through the park or a hike through the woods, spending time in nature can have numerous benefits for both our physical and mental well-being. One of the greatest advantages of taking a nature walk is that you can do it at your own pace. Unlike structured workouts or fitness classes, there is no pressure to keep up with others or meet certain expectations. You can simply take your time and enjoy the beauty around you while also getting some exercise. Nature walks are also great for clearing our minds and reducing stress levels. Being surrounded by greenery has been proven to have a calming effect on our brains, helping us to relax and unwind. This can also lead to improved mood, as spending time in nature has been linked to increased levels of serotonin, a neurotransmitter that contributes to feelings of happiness and well-being.

51. Morning Pages
Engage in the therapeutic practice of freeform writing as soon as you wake up. Set aside 10-15 minutes to write stream-of-consciousness thoughts, feelings, and ideas. Don’t worry about spelling or grammar – just let your mind flow onto the page. This can help clear your mind and set a positive tone for the rest of the day.

How do I schedule my time for myself?
Scheduling time for yourself might seem like a daunting task, especially when you’re juggling multiple responsibilities. It’s great to have the me time ideas, but how do you fit this time in? However, it’s essential to remember that when you spend time with yourself is not just an act of self-love, but also a necessity for maintaining overall well-being. Here are some me time tips on how to have me time and really make the most of your personal time.
Firstly, start by setting clear boundaries and prioritising your needs. This could mean turning off your work emails after a certain hour, or saying ‘no’ to social obligations that drain your energy.
Next, try to incorporate small pockets of ‘me time’ into your daily routine. This doesn’t have to be anything extravagant. Even taking 10 minutes to enjoy a cup of coffee in silence can make a huge difference.
Lastly, make use of planning tools to help manage your time better. This could be a physical planner or a digital app. By visually mapping out your day, you’ll be able to see where you can squeeze in some much-needed personal time.
Remember, the goal isn’t to completely isolate yourself from the world but to find a balance that allows you to recharge and thrive. So, go ahead and start spending time with the most important person in your life – you!
